This is a very random question, I know. I was playing Silent Service II on Dosbox yesterday, and somehow I pressed something that stretched my fullscreen resolution from normal to widescreen. Whatever I pressed originally screwed up the resolution of my desktop (Windows 😎, as well. I fixed my Windows desktop and no other program has this problem, but I cannot figure out for the life of me how to fix the fullscreen resolution of Dosbox. I have tried Dosbox options, key mapper, and even uninstalling and reinstalling the program. It is incredibly frustrating and makes my games look like garbage. Any ideas how to fix this??? Thanks!

Yes, I would say that sounds very likely.

Exactly what happened depends on what graphics card you are using. There is probably some key combination configured in its software (e.g., the Nvidia control panel) to change the aspect ratio and/or resolution.
